1.26 "Counting" by measuring mass Sometimes chemists need to "count" out a specific number of atoms, ions or molecules of a substance. Atoms are very very small - too small to see. It is therefore impossible to measure them out by counting individually. Instead we "count" them out by measuring their mass - much like ...
